About the speaker

Crystal Widjaja is a product and growth practitioner with experience leading some of the fastest growing companies in Asia. Her most popular content include Why Most Analytics Efforts Fail, Lenny Rachitsky's Podcast: How to scrappily hire for, measure, and unlock growth, and her co-authored Data for Product Managers course with Shaun Clowes.

Previously, Crystal was SVP of Growth and Data at Gojek, a “super app” for multiple consumer service businesses. Gojek completes more rides per day than Lyft; more food deliveries than GrubHub, Uber Eats, and DoorDash combined; and is the #1 mobile wallet across Southeast Asia. During her 5-year tenure, Crystal helped grow Gojek from 30K to over 5M orders per day. Her last role at Gojek was as Chief of Staff to the co-CEOs of the 6000+ large decacorn.

Crystal is an Angel investor through the Monk's Hill and Sequoia Scout programs, a former EIR and current Subject Matter Expert at Reforge, advisor to companies including Scale.AI, AB-inBev, Maze, Carousell, CRED, and Eppo, and cofounder of Generation Girl, a non-profit focused on increasing STEM access for young women in Indonesia. Crystal has been named Forbes 30 Under 30, 2021 Marketech APAC Leader of the year, and HerWorld's Woman of the Year.
